Best Home Treadmill for Large Person - Buying Guide
Weight Capacity
One of the critical features to consider when selecting the Best Home Treadmill for Large Person is its weight capacity. Look for models with a capacity of at least 300 pounds to ensure consistent performance and durability. Commercial-grade treadmills often accommodate up to 400 pounds, offering additional peace of mind.
Running Surface Dimensions
Larger users tend to have a longer stride, so choosing a treadmill with a spacious running deck is essential. Look for decks that are at least 20 inches wide and 60 inches long. A longer deck ensures safe, unrestricted movement during your workout.
Motor Power
The motor is the heart of any treadmill, and for heavy users, a powerful motor is crucial. Opt for treadmills with a motor of at least 3.0 HP to handle your weight without compromising on performance. Motors with higher horsepower are also better for supporting longer running sessions and inclines.
Cushioning and Shock Absorption
Running on a treadmill can be hard on your joints, especially for heavier users. Models with advanced cushioning systems or shock-absorbing decks can significantly reduce the impact on your knees and ankles, making your workouts more comfortable and preventing potential injuries.
Stability and Frame Durability
A treadmill for larger persons should have a sturdy and stable frame to support consistent use. Heavy-duty steel frames are preferred as they provide stronger support and last longer. If a treadmill feels wobbly or lacks a solid foundation, it may not be the right choice for your needs.
Display Features and Connectivity
A well-lit, intuitive display can enhance your workout experience. Modern treadmills often come with HD touchscreens, Bluetooth integration, and fitness app compatibility, giving you access to metrics, virtual training sessions, and entertainment during exercise.

The Role of Inclines in Weight Loss
Treadmills with incline features can significantly enhance your weight loss efforts. By simulating uphill walking or running, the incline engages different muscle groups, increases calorie burn, and strengthens your lower body. Top Safety Features to Look for in Treadmills
Safety should always be a top priority when choosing a treadmill, especially for heavier users. Look for features like emergency stop buttons, non-slip running surfaces, and handrails for added support. Heart rate monitors and cushioning systems also play a vital role in ensuring a secure and stress-free workout experience.
